Mukesh Khanna has come out in support of the Maharashtra Food and Drug Administration's (FDA) recent show-cause notices issued to Shah Rukh Khan, Ajay Devgn and Tiger Shroff over their association with an advertisement allegedly indirectly promoting pan masala. The veteran actor said celebrities endorsing such products should take responsibility for the message they send to their audiences.
